1. The U.S. September non-farm payrolls will be released tonight. This is the first monthly employment report issued by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ics since the release of August data in September, filling the gap in official employment data caused by the previous government shutdown. The market generally expects an increase of 54,000 in non-farm payrolls for September, with the unemployment rate remaining at 4.3%. However, this data is significantly lagging, and the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ics has clearly stated that it will not release the October non-farm report.
2. According to foreign media reports, "China is considering new real estate stimulus policies." Today, real estate stocks showed unusual movements, with the real estate sectors in both A-shares and Hong Kong stocks collectively rising. The rapid market reaction highlights the market's anticipation of a relaxation in real estate policies, but this policy rumor has not yet been officially confirmed.

1.$CATL(03750.HK)
On November 20, approximately 77.5 million H shares of CATL's IPO cornerstone investors will be unlocked. This is the largest release of tradable shares since its listing in Hong Kong in May. Currently, CATL's H shares have a premium of about 23% over A shares. The news of the unlocking has already led to a significant drop in the H share price, falling more than 6% intraday. Previously, the company's third-largest shareholder also conducted a large share transfer, further drawing market attention to the circulation of shares.
2.$Broadcom(AVGO.US)
Broadcom launched the Brocade X8 Director and other eighth-generation 128G SAN switch product combinations, the world's first of its kind with quantum security features. This product embeds SAN AI technology, enabling infrastructure management automation to optimize performance and defend against future quantum computer threats to sensitive data and critical infrastructure. It is mainly suitable for enterprise storage and modern data center scenarios. For Broadcom, it can strengthen its competitiveness in the semiconductor and infrastructure software fields and seize the market opportunity related to quantum security.
3.$AMD(AMD.US)
AMD, Cisco, and Saudi AI company Humain announced the establishment of a joint venture, planning to build up to 1 gigawatt of AI infrastructure by 2030, with construction starting in 2026. The first phase, with 100-megawatt capacity, will use AMD's GPUs and Cisco's infrastructure, and Luma AI has been signed as the first customer. AMD and Cisco can leverage the collaboration to expand the market for AI hardware and infrastructure, while Humain can accelerate the construction of Saudi Arabia's AI ecosystem by relying on the technology of giants.
